Canterbury Pilgrims and Their Ways offers a fascinating exploration into the world of medieval pilgrimage, particularly focusing on the iconic journey to Canterbury Cathedral. Francis Watt delves into the historical context of these pilgrimages, shedding light on the motivations, experiences, and social dynamics of the pilgrims who traversed the English countryside.
